The British Transport Police Roll of Honour (Line of Duty) records the deaths of railway, dock and canal police officers who have died in the line of duty. These officers are also remembered on the National Police Officers Roll of Honour and Remembrance, recorded by the name of each individual constituent force.

The classes of death used in this Roll of Honour are:

  • Acts of Violence
    includes all forms of unlawful killing (murder, manslaughter etc.) of officers on duty. Similarly, if they are off duty and their occupation as a police officer is a factor.
  • Misadventure
    refers to death resulting from accidental injury incurred in the performance of a duty involving special risks (e.g. rescue etc).
  • Accident
    refers to death resulting from unforeseen accidental injury whilst on routine duty. It does include death from accidents that occurred while travelling to or returning from duty.
  • Enemy Action
    is death as a result of injuries incurred during wartime air raids.
  • Death by Natural Causes
    is included if it occurred while performing a particular duty which contributed to the death (e.g. heart attack whilst chasing a suspect). Officers on duty who have died of natural causes in ordinary circumstances are included in the Remembrance list.
  • Remembrance
    Officers who have died of natural causes whilst on duty or travelling to or from duty, and there is no contributing ‘police duty’ related factor. Officers killed in air raids whilst off duty. Serving officers killed off duty by an act of violence where there is no ‘police duty’ related factor. Serving officers who have succumbed to the Covid19 virus pandemic.

Where possible the details of the death will have been confirmed and checked against at least two sources. However, information from a single source is acceptable if it is perceived to be reliable. Where conflicting information is found, further research will be conducted until a reasoned judgement as to accuracy can be made. Where we are still investigating the death, the officers name will be placed on the working list but not on the public Roll of Honour as it appears on the website.

Sources
The names included in the Roll of Honour have been gathered from various sources. In many cases the starting point was the list of names provided by Anthony Rae, who masterminded the National Police Roll of Honour and who took a great deal of information from his detailed study of the long-standing magazine Police Review. Kevin Gordon provided much of the original information from BTP records with some additions by Viv Head from his study of railway and dock policing in South Wales.

Update March 2015: Further research has been conducted by Viv Head, and this has yielded a number of additions and changes to the names on the list.
An additional table showing Non-Railway Officers killed on duty on the railway can be found below.

Update August 2018: Additional work by Viv Head and Glyn Thomas on the ‘Non-Railway Officers killed on duty on the railway’ table has now increased the number of officers recorded from four to eighty-one.

Update September 2018: Officers who died of natural causes whilst on duty have now been placed on a separate ‘In Remembrance’ table below.

Update October 2020: Additional work by Viv Head, Glyn Thomas and Martin McKay, to verify existing and additional entries, and liaise with the National Roll of Honour, who were missing a considerable number of RDC officers. Also many thanks to Steve Beamon who was critical in doing additional research.
